partout-io / passepartout

Your go-to app for VPN and privacy.

Swift · KotlinGPL-3.0★ 1,327 stars⑂ 163 forkssince Oct 2018View on GitHub ↗

partout-io/passepartout holds a health index of 77 out of 100, placing it in the Good band. It scores highest on Vitality (98/100) and lowest on AI Readiness (49/100). It was last updated today. A single contributor accounts for most of its recent work.
